What Does WAT Stand For?

WAT stands for Web Action Time

WAT (Web Action Time) refers to a performance metric that quantifies the time taken for a web application to respond to user interactions. It measures the latency between a user's action, such as clicking a button or submitting a form, and the application's corresponding response. Optimizing WAT is crucial for enhancing user experience, reducing bounce rates, and improving overall engagement on digital platforms.
